For those looking for a quality thrift shop in the San Fernando Valley or LA area, Council Thrift Shops, is an excellent choice. These thrift shops have been ranked in the top ten across the country.
The shops were first founded back in 1924. They were a result that came of the Immigrant Aid Program. The very first store included household items. Today there are eight different stores, and they now receive over 50,000 donations each year.
A variety of items are available at Council Thrift Shops. Customers can find clothing for men, women, and kids. Furniture is available, collectibles can be found, and even jewelry, appliances, and accessories are available.
The clientele includes a wide variety of people, from actors, to musicians, costumers, and more. The revenues that are generated from the eight different stores work to provide funding to programs in the community for children, families, and at risk women.
Donations can be dropped off at stores every single day of the week. If an estate is donated to the shops, Council Thrift Shops will pack and pick up everything. To find out more about pick up or drop off, you can call 1-800-400-6259 or 323-655-3111 if you are local.
